What does a long snapper do in the NFL?

W

In gridiron football, the long snapper (or deep snapper) is a special teams specialist whose duty is to snap the football over a longer distance, typically around 15 yards during punts, and 7–8 yards during field goals and extra point attempts.

How much does long snapper make in NFL?

Long snappers get paid the least of any position in the NFL

With an average pay of $930,463 per year, long snapper is not only the lowest-paid position but also the only position group tracked by Spotrac that falls under a $1 million average salary.

Can the snapper run the ball?

Answer: Yes, they can pass the ball, run with the ball, etc. But they are ineligible to CATCH a forward pass. … Again the touching must be intentional; if the ball simply hits him, that’s not illegal touching. Question: Can an offensive lineman EVER catch a forward pass?

How do I get better at long snapper?

Grip the football ready for the snap, cupping it with your palm up and your guide hand on top with your middle finger on the seam. When you snap the football, bring your elbows in so they hit your inner thighs. This creates a long arm action, giving you a powerful snap on a line back to your punter.

What makes a long snapper good?

Given, the whole process starts with the most important person on the team, the Long Snapper. Your snap needs to be a good, consistent tempo at all times. It is very hard for a punter to get a rhythm with a Long Snapper if one snap is a rocket and the other is a floater.

What is the average size of an NFL long snapper?

The average NFL snapper in 2017 was 6’2.5 and 244 pounds. Rubio says if he were building a snapper from scratch, he’d be about 6’4 and 235. Just one was under 6-foot. FBS snappers ranged between 6’6 and 5’9, per Gold’s research at Longsnap.com.
